All the characteristics of a cell depend on the molecules it contains. A molecule is defined as a cluster of atoms held together by covalent bonds; here electrons are shared between atoms to complete the outer shells, rather than https://datingranking.net/fr/sites-de-rencontre-musulmans/ being transferred between them. In the simplest possible molecule-a molecule of hydrogen (H2)-two H atoms, each with a single electron, share two electrons, which is the number required to fill the first shell. These shared electrons form a cloud of negative charge that is densest between the two positively charged nuclei and helps to hold them together, in opposition to the mutual repulsion between like charges that would otherwise force them apart. The attractive and repulsive forces are in balance when the nuclei are separated by a characteristic distance, called the bond length.
